Industrial

You can choose from a variety of styles, including industrial leather sofas. These couches are often made with an unfinished wood frame which is dried in a kiln to prevent cracking, warping or mildew. For stability, they may have steel legs or a mix of metal and wooden legs. Some companies make use of particleboard or plywood instead of solid hardwood for sofa frames. Frank says that these materials do not last as long as solid wood.

The best choice for a sofa made of industrial leather is real top-grain or full-grain leather, which is resistant to fading and staining better than faux or leather that is bonded. It is also resistant to spills and tears better than leatherette, which can peel or flake over time. This material is a good option for families with children and pets since it is resistant to scratching, scuffing and tearing better than vinyl or polyurethane fabrics. In contrast to fabric, leather doesn't store dust mites and allergens.
